Conwy, Wales: A Medieval Castle and the Ironworks of Robert Louis Stevenson's Railway Bridge This photograph, taken circa 1905, showcases the picturesque town of Conwy in Wales, with its iconic medieval castle and the winding River Conwy. The scene is dominated by the imposing Conwy Castle, which was built between 1283 and 1289 during the late 13th century under the command of Edward I. The castle's impressive stone walls and towers, standing tall against the backdrop of the Welsh landscape, have withstood the test of time and continue to draw visitors from around the world. In the foreground, the intricate arches of the Conwy Suspension Bridge, designed by Thomas Telford, can be seen, albeit partially obscured by the more recent Conwy Railway Bridge.
